Michael Comella
f49fc6dad2
For #8803 : hook up frameworkStart metric.
2020-04-17 09:11:58 -07:00
Michael Comella
dbf733d70a
For #8803 : add StartupFrameworkStartMeasurement.
...
This class controls the central logic around the metrics we want to
record.
2020-04-17 09:11:58 -07:00
Michael Comella
7f618a6a7c
For #8803 : add Stat and test.
...
We need to access the data in stat to get the process start time, so we
can calculate the time from process start until application.init for the
frameworkStart probe.
2020-04-17 09:11:58 -07:00
Emily Kager
39107b4036
For #9703 - Exit fullscreen in onPause and onSessionSelected ( #10016 )
...
* For #9703 - Call fullScreenChanged in onPause
* For #10015 - Exit full screen if new session selected
2020-04-17 08:57:36 -07:00
ekager
6f77ec5951
Use HomeFragment viewLifecycleOwner for BrowserSessionsObserver
2020-04-16 21:00:27 -07:00
Grisha Kruglov
0ec6d266e8
Use HomeFragment's viewLifecycleOwner as the lifecycle for accountManager observer registry
...
If we just use the HomeFragment itself, we end up with a memory leak since the lifecycle events
that would clean up the registry (e.g. destroy) won't run (if the fragment is retained in the backstack, for example).
2020-04-16 21:00:27 -07:00
Mihai Adrian
72fe9fad0c
For #9987 : Set FLAG_SECURE to dialog when flag set in activity. ( #9998 )
...
* For #9987 : Add extension to secures dialog if parent activity is secured
* For #9987 : Set FLAG_SECURE to dialog when flag set in activity
2020-04-16 20:33:57 -07:00
mozilla-l10n-automation-bot
dbbd048b6c
Import l10n. ( #10011 )
2020-04-16 20:32:21 -07:00
Emily Kager
1df9c53b9f
Fix: Set correct height for EditText ( #10014 )
...
Created a dimension for the correct height that the EditText in the
fragment_edit_bookmark.xml has to have.
Co-authored-by: DrCesar <josuejacobstercero@gmail.com>
2020-04-16 20:31:25 -07:00
Mihai Eduard Badea
725ba1e856
For #9951 - Removed the extra empty spaces that were causing the spacing issue
2020-04-16 20:12:18 -07:00
mcarare
5a2a779ef5
For #9565 : Adjust padding and height to allow longer text
2020-04-16 20:10:45 -07:00
mcarare
e87ea301ab
For #9536 : Update tests to check opened tab is in same browsing mode
2020-04-16 19:50:25 -07:00
mcarare
83d2208c6b
For #9536 : Open report issue tab depending on current browsing mode.
...
Checking if session is private uses the new browser state API.
2020-04-16 19:50:25 -07:00
mcarare
8440f1867a
For #9989 : Add start & end margin to button.
2020-04-16 19:43:34 -07:00
Sawyer Blatz
1f8f69548a
For #7158 : Fixes browser to search animation fade
2020-04-16 14:03:26 -07:00
ekager
6df11619fd
No issue: Uses NeutralButton for Migration Activity
2020-04-16 13:14:34 -07:00
Jonathan Almeida
2bb1b6edad
For #8422 : Add misc migration UI fixes
2020-04-16 12:02:02 -07:00
Jonathan Almeida
25d5b0d31c
For #8422 : Add spacing between migration items
2020-04-16 12:02:02 -07:00
ekager
4a06a228f3
For #9981 - Make Bookmark Menu UI respond to session selection
2020-04-16 10:49:16 -07:00
mcarare
25e12e2f77
For #9984 : Update addon before settings visibility check
2020-04-16 10:25:37 -04:00
Mozilla L10n Automation Bot
3e8836f71a
Import l10n.
2020-04-16 10:13:30 +03:00
ekager
688a33522b
For #9516 - Adds selectable background to dialog and snackbar buttons
2020-04-16 10:13:08 +03:00
Sawyer Blatz
8185ba793e
For #9857 : Create button style ( #9858 )
...
* For #9857 : Creates text button style
* Adds lint check
* Fixes onboarding cards
2020-04-15 15:49:02 -07:00
Jonathan Almeida
997f6c72d6
For #9409 : Add app icon to Leanplum push notifications
2020-04-15 17:55:12 -04:00
Jonathan Almeida
e97904662c
Remove duplicate FirebasePushService
...
When we moved push to it's own component the class was supposed to have
been moved but git might have only picked it up as an addition.
2020-04-15 17:55:12 -04:00
Mihai Branescu
bded28a017
For #9420 - relaxed custom engine rules ( #9967 )
...
Allow websites that return 404 to be added
Change long query param with one with higher changes of being found
2020-04-15 13:20:06 -07:00
ValentinTimisica
c7b123cfea
Fixes #9710 : Vertically aligns users_count with rating ( #9950 )
2020-04-15 10:51:55 -07:00
ekager
aef827e607
For #9887 - Respect screenshot setting when resetting window flags in logins
2020-04-15 09:03:26 -07:00
Jeff Boek
06f1b6c992
No Issue - Fixes nav_graph issues ( #9926 )
2020-04-15 08:34:45 -07:00
Arturo Mejia
37a277febb
For issue #9930 Do not assume all add-ons have a settings page
2020-04-15 06:20:34 -04:00
Mozilla L10n Automation Bot
9a298ea6ba
Import l10n.
2020-04-15 03:50:48 +03:00
ekager
2056b6f2ff
Update UI test to match Support Page title
2020-04-14 11:34:55 -07:00
ekager
55b04b9885
Update Server.dev to Server.stage to fix A-S upgrade breaking change
2020-04-14 11:34:55 -07:00
Arturo Mejia
8872baef39
Update Android Components version
2020-04-14 11:34:55 -07:00
Arturo Mejia
7c279b6e1f
No issue: Fix add-on translate() breaking change
2020-04-14 11:34:55 -07:00
ekager
5b1cdbd8bf
For #3194 - Pause media while undo snackbar appears
2020-04-14 09:55:39 +03:00
ekager
9c56a8b387
For #204 - Remove PWA Feature Flag
2020-04-14 09:55:14 +03:00
Mozilla L10n Automation Bot
69c7196e77
Import l10n.
2020-04-14 09:54:30 +03:00
Jeff Boek
4cbb9aebaf
Cleans up nav_graph.xml ( #9829 )
...
* For #9751 - Cleans up homeFragment directions
* For #9751 - Uses global actions for fragments not owned by homeFragment
* For #9751 - Cleans up SearchFragment directions
* For #9751 - Removes settings action from DeleteBrowsingDataFragment
* For #9751 - Removes browser action from SettingsFragment
* For #9751 - Adds ManagePhoneFeature global action
* For #9751 - Clean up unused deletebrowsingfragment actions
* For #9751 - Cleans Up HistoryFragment actions
* For #9751 - Removes Home -> Search action
* For #9751 - Removes the Bookmark -> Browser action
* For #9751 - Cleans up bookmark fragment actions
* For #9751 - Cleans up actions from ShareController
* For #9751 - Removes defaultBrowserFragment to browserFragment action
* For #9751 - Removes about -> browser action
* For #9751 - Adds global action to TrackingProtectionFragment
* For #9751 - Removes exception -> browser action
* For #9751 - Removes login -> browser action
* For #9751 - Fixes LoginFragment directions
* For #9751 - Removes ExternalAppBrowser directions
* for #9751 - Cleans up actions
* For #9751 - Fixes unit tests
* For #9751 - Addresses nits in PR
2020-04-13 21:43:45 -07:00
Arturo Mejia
eace991859
For issue #8520 : Improve add-ons UI
2020-04-13 19:01:58 -04:00
ekager
b8fba63be4
For #9890 - Do not display full screen snackbar with toolbar padding
2020-04-13 14:56:51 -07:00
ekager
ac3a557ddf
For #9703 - Exit full screen on pause if pip not entered
2020-04-13 14:31:57 -07:00
Sawyer Blatz
7c3394ea7c
For #9892 : Set dynamicToolbarMaxHeigtht to 0 for PWAs ( #9893 )
2020-04-13 13:08:08 -07:00
ekager
8c238402e2
For #9692 - Fix "Install" PWA menu item labeling
2020-04-13 10:09:37 -07:00
ekager
5039546dc5
For #7208 For #7212 - Update parameterized strings
2020-04-13 09:40:47 -07:00
Oana Horvath
52857b09d7
fix #9670 intermittent tests ( #9767 )
...
also disabled intermittent closePrivateTabsNotification
2020-04-13 13:17:35 +03:00
mcarare
8cdc523de9
For #9698 : Add unit tests for Context extension getStringWithArgSafe
2020-04-13 09:40:00 +03:00
mcarare
a214f04b4a
For #9698 : Use extension to ensure fallback to English and avoid crash
2020-04-13 09:40:00 +03:00
mcarare
4a1a875233
For #9698 : Add Context extension to avoid format IllegalArgumentException
2020-04-13 09:40:00 +03:00
Mozilla L10n Automation Bot
e1bc8dc190
Import l10n.
2020-04-13 09:38:41 +03:00